For freedom, from ancient to nom philosophers have made a different elaboration, but too excessive about the description of the freedom phenomenon, and they did not know why people does need to be free, and what is the foundation of freedom. Although Marx established materialist conception of history, he did not make a direct elaboration about the issue of freedom. Therefore, nowadays, the research of Marx's theory of freedom concept doesn't form a unified understanding, and its real meaning is still waiting for revealed. Although some scholars interpret the Marx's concept of freedom with the method of practice At most point out the method of get freedom, not point out that freedom is one kind of human's material activities, is the societal wealth which is created by humankind to use for control our behaviour. Therefore when they define the word"freedom'', they indicate it by the ontology or the epistemology. In this paper, in order to understand the real meaning Marx's concept of freedom, we begin with his early theory of freedom. Despite the early thinking is immature, we can also understand Marx's thinking process, which is rather necessary in the research of freedom.With this intention, the paper briefly describes the preamble of the current interpretation of Marx's theory of freedom. I point out their flaws, and put forward my opinion. In the first﹑two﹑three parts, mainly elaborate Marx's evolution theory of freedom. In this process of change, Marx's theory of freedom experience process of immature to mature, until established scientific theory of freedom. In this process of change we think that Marx concerned about the real lives of freedom to guide the direction of his research. Separate from the direction, is impossible to establish scientific communism. Especially to participate in political struggle, Marx clearly to realize that material interest play a very important role among people. This is a great turning point in the thinking of Marx .Just Engels sends Richard Fischer the letter said:"I am completely sure, because I have heard Marx said more once. For his study on the law of forest theft and the condition of farmers in Mosel River land, impelled him to turn study of a purely political to economic relations, and thus toward socialism''Seize the struggle of the material interest, from this entrance use, we can find the laws of social development, a scientific theory of freedom is very easy to revealed. Along this line, at the end of this paper, we elaborate the real meaning of the theory of Marx's freedom from material interest.
